Indian model Bhavitha Mandava makes history as the first Indian to be named a house ambassador for Chanel.
In a landmark moment for global fashion industry, Mandava’s new role marks a huge step forward not just for her own modelling career but for Indian representation in international luxury fashion overall.
On May 7, Mandava posted on the news on Instagram writing : writing, “CHANEL has long stood as a symbol of the modern working woman in motion, a spirit I deeply resonate with and am proud to embody. Matthieu’s vision for the house brings a genuine sense of joy, thoughtfully balanced with reverence for its legacy. “I’m truly honoured to be part of this new chapter at CHANEL and to join as an ambassador for a house that holds a special place in my heart.”
Taking on the prestigious role at the iconic French luxury brand is not the first time that Mandava – who made her but debut on the Chanel runway for Matthieu Blazy’s debut collection last season – has created history.
She also etched her name in history this past December, as the first Indian model to open a Chanel show, leading the Métiers d’Art collection in New York City.
Mandava has steadily built her presence in global fashion, most recently closing the Chanel haute couture show in January 2026 in a stunning bridal look.
From a student pursuing master’s degree in integrated design and media in New York to be scouted on the subway in 2024, Mandava’s rise to the forefront of global fashion happened within a few weeks as Matthieu Blazy casted her in a runway show, launching a career that’s gained momentum with ferocity.
Marking her presence on runways as much as in leading fashion magazine spreads, Bhavitha Mandava’s role at Chanel kicks off a new chapter not just for herself but also sets the standard for what Indian models can bring to global luxury fashion.
